Rambler's Top100
Форум: MS ACCESSVBVBA MS OfficeMS SQL server
Новые сообщения: 0000

Форум: MS ACCESS

Вопросы связанные с MS ACCESS

Обновить визитку
Участники «Online»
Все участники

 
 

Доброго времени суток, Посетитель!

вид форума:
Линейный форум Структурный форум

тема: Создание запроса программно
 
 автор: Елена_Л   (06.10.2006 в 16:02)
 
 

Подскажите, пожалуйста, возможно ли это? Требуется для диаграммы построить перекрестный запрос с определенным порядком столбцов, т.е. в PIVOT для создания легенды диаграммы указать, например:
TRANSFORM ... SELECT ... FROM .... WHERE .... GROUP BY ...
PIVOT поле in ('9 мес 2005 г','сентябрь 2006 г','9 мес 2006 г')

Благодарю за помощь

  Ответить  
 
 автор: osmor   (06.10.2006 в 16:16)   личное сообщение
 
 

новый так:
call currentdb.CreateQueryDef("ИмяЗапроса","TRANSFORM ... SELECT ... FROM .... WHERE .... GROUP BY ...)
изменить существующий:
currentdb.querydefs("ИмяЗапроса").sql = "TRANSFORM ... SELECT ... FROM .... WHERE .... GROUP BY ...

  Ответить  
 
 автор: Елена_Л   (06.10.2006 в 17:08)
 
 

Спасибо большое. Все получилось!

  Ответить  
HiProg.com - Технологии программирования
Rambler's Top100 TopList